    FOCUSED ON THEIR FAMILIES: Religion, Parenting, & Child Well-being

    In recent years, scholars have drawn attention to religious commitments to patriarchy and parental authority to argue that religion—especially conservative Protestantism—fosters an authoritarian approach to parenting. Indeed, using data from the National Survey of Families and Households (NSFH), this study does find that religious attendance and theological conservatism are associated with higher levels of corporal punishment among parents—potentially an indicator of authoritarian parenting. But religious attendance and theological conservatism are also associated with lower levels of parental yelling and with higher levels of praising and hugging among parents, which are indicators of an authoritative style of parenting. Moreover, data from the Survey of Adults and Youth (SAY) indicate that religious attendance and orthodoxy are generally associated with greater parental investments in childrearing, more intergenerational closure, and more social control. In other words, conservative Protestants, Orthodox Jews, traditional Catholics, and other parents who regularly attend religious services are more likely than other parents to adopt an authoritative style of parenting that is beneficial to children.

    Bonding Alone: Familism, Religion, and Secular Civic Participation

    This study examines the influence of familism, religion, and their interaction on participation in secular voluntary associations. We develop an insularity theory to explain how familism and religion encourage Americans to avoid secular civic participation. Using data from the first wave of the National Survey of Families and Households, this study finds that familism reduces participation in secular organizations. Moreover, religion moderates the effect of familism: specifically, religious involvement tends to increase the negative effect of familism on secular civic participation. Although religious involvement in and of itself fosters secular civic participation, strong familism tends to dampen positive impacts of religious involvement. For familistic individuals, religious congregations appear to reinforce their insularity within their immediate social circle and family

    The School to Family Pipeline: What Do Religious, Private, and Public Schooling Have to Do with Family Formation?

    Private religious schools are widely seen as value-laden communities that mold the character of their students. Thus, we expect adults who attended religious schools as children to demonstrate more favorable family outcomes related to stable marriages and childbearing. We further expect Protestant schooling to have a more powerful effect on marital outcomes than Catholic schooling, given the heavier focus of Protestantism on marriage. Finally, we expect stronger positive associations between religious schooling and marital outcomes for adults who grew up in difficult circumstances compared to adults who grew up in advantaged circumstances. We test these hypotheses using survey data from the Understanding America Study. Our three outcome variables are ever marrying and never divorcing, ever divorcing, and conceiving a child out-of-wedlock. Most of the results confirm our hypotheses. Protestant schooling is associated with more positive marital outcomes across all three measures. Catholic schooling is significantly correlated with a lower likelihood of having a child outside of marriage. The associations between religious schooling and desirable marriage outcomes are strongest for adults who grew up poor and for those raised in intact families

    Making the Grade: Family Structure and Children’s Educational Participation in Colombia, Egypt, India, Kenya, Nigeria, Peru & Uruguay

    Research in the U.S. and much of the developed world suggests that children in intact, twoparent households typically do better on educational outcomes than do children in singleparent and step-family households. While studies in the developed world generally indicate that family structure influences educational outcomes, less is known about whether children living with their two biological parents in the developing world have better educational outcomes, all things being equal, than children in step- or single-parent families, or children living in households without a biological parent. This is an important gap in the literature because step- and single-parent families are becoming more common in much of the developing world. Using data drawn from Demographic and Health Surveys in six countries (Colombia, Egypt, India, Kenya, Nigeria, & Peru) and from the Continuous Household Survey in Uruguay, we find that secondary-school-age children are more likely to participate in schooling if they live with at least one biological parent. Moreover, children in Colombia and Uruguay are also more likely to be enrolled in school if they live with two parents

    Religious Identity, Religious Attendance, and Parental Control

    Using a national sample of adolescents aged 10–18 years and their parents (N = 5,117), this article examines whether parental religious identity and religious participation are associated with the ways in which parents control their children. We hypothesize that both religious orthodoxy and weekly religious attendance are related to heightened levels of three elements of parental control: monitoring activities, normative regulations, and network closure. Results indicate that an orthodox religious identity for Catholic and Protestant parents and higher levels of religious attendance for parents as a whole are associated with increases in monitoring activities and normative regulations of American adolescents

    Ocean acidification alters morphology of all otolith types in Clark’s anemonefish (Amphiprion clarkii)

    Ocean acidification, the ongoing decline of surface ocean pH and [CO 32{}_{3}^{2-} 3 2 − ] due to absorption of surplus atmospheric CO2, has far-reaching consequences for marine biota, especially calcifiers. Among these are teleost fishes, which internally calcify otoliths, critical elements of the inner ear and vestibular system. There is evidence in the literature that ocean acidification increases otolith size and alters shape, perhaps impacting otic mechanics and thus sensory perception. Here, larval Clark’s anemonefish, Amphiprion clarkii (Bennett, 1830), were reared in various seawater pCO2/pH treatments analogous to future ocean scenarios. At the onset of metamorphosis, all otoliths were removed from each individual fish and analyzed for treatment effects on morphometrics including area, perimeter, and circularity; scanning electron microscopy was used to screen for evidence of treatment effects on lateral development, surface roughness, and vaterite replacement. The results corroborate those of other experiments with other taxa that observed otolith growth with elevated pCO2, and provide evidence that lateral development and surface roughness increased as well. Both sagittae exhibited increasing area, perimeter, lateral development, and roughness; left lapilli exhibited increasing area and perimeter while right lapilli exhibited increasing lateral development and roughness; and left asterisci exhibited increasing perimeter, roughness, and ellipticity with increasing pCO2. Right lapilli and left asterisci were only impacted by the most extreme pCO2 treatment, suggesting they are resilient to any conditions short of aragonite undersaturation, while all other impacted otoliths responded to lower concentrations. Finally, fish settlement competency at 10 dph was dramatically reduced, and fish standard length marginally reduced with increasing pCO2. Increasing abnormality and asymmetry of otoliths may impact inner ear function by altering otolith-maculae interactions

    Whole-genome sequencing reveals host factors underlying critical COVID-19

    Critical COVID-19 is caused by immune-mediated inflammatory lung injury. Host genetic variation influences the development of illness requiring critical care1 or hospitalization2–4 after infection with SARS-CoV-2. The GenOMICC (Genetics of Mortality in Critical Care) study enables the comparison of genomes from individuals who are critically ill with those of population controls to find underlying disease mechanisms. Here we use whole-genome sequencing in 7,491 critically ill individuals compared with 48,400 controls to discover and replicate 23 independent variants that significantly predispose to critical COVID-19. We identify 16 new independent associations, including variants within genes that are involved in interferon signalling (IL10RB and PLSCR1), leucocyte differentiation (BCL11A) and blood-type antigen secretor status (FUT2). Using transcriptome-wide association and colocalization to infer the effect of gene expression on disease severity, we find evidence that implicates multiple genes—including reduced expression of a membrane flippase (ATP11A), and increased expression of a mucin (MUC1)—in critical disease. Mendelian randomization provides evidence in support of causal roles for myeloid cell adhesion molecules (SELE, ICAM5 and CD209) and the coagulation factor F8, all of which are potentially druggable targets. Our results are broadly consistent with a multi-component model of COVID-19 pathophysiology, in which at least two distinct mechanisms can predispose to life-threatening disease: failure to control viral replication; or an enhanced tendency towards pulmonary inflammation and intravascular coagulation. We show that comparison between cases of critical illness and population controls is highly efficient for the detection of therapeutically relevant mechanisms of disease
